Vibe coding: A threat to software engineers?

Share via:


Vibe coding” is the latest buzzword in the arena of artificial intelligence (AI), describing a development in generative AI that some believe makes programming as simple as a texting a friend.

In a post on X in February, OpenAI cofounder Andrej Karpathy, who coined the term, said, “There’s a new kind of coding I call ‘vibe coding’, where you fully give in to the vibes, embrace exponentials, and forget that the code even exists.”

According to the news agency AFP, vibe coding refers to the process of instantly generating code using generative AI…
